Wellness

…A little Wellness Goes a Long Way!

Employer Benefits By Receiving:

  • Better attendance
  • Lower health insurance premiums
  • Lower workers compensation costs
  • Happier more productive employees
  • Decrease turnover
  • Increase performance and productivity
  • Personal and professional balance
  • Quality of life
  • Improved employee morale and company image

Concerns of Wellness Programs:

  • Can be expensive If not maintained/ not committed to wellness programs there will be no positive return
  • Does not result in immediate savings
  • Time consuming (employees are away from their job duties)
  • Whose time is used? The companies’ or the employee’s?
  • Health Insurance Portability and Accountability ACT (HIPAA) concerns
  • Employee Assistance Programs  (EAP)
  • Others who do not take advantage of the wellness program may affect coworkers negatively.

Leading Causes of Stress in the Workplace:

Lack of personal control over workplace changes:

  • Reductions in force
  • Major departmental reorganizations
  • Mergers and acquisitions

Personal:

  • Lack of time
  • Physical health
  • Lack of joy
  • Family relationships
  • Friends/social life
  • Lack of self-esteem
  • Marriage/primary relationship

Studies Find...

  • Working out (the importance of sweating) in a rescent study claims that those who exercise, missed 40% fewer workdays than those who did not exercise regularly.
  • Employees will stay on the job for workplace health and wellness programs.
  • Health screenings, nutrition programs, blood pressure monitoring and stress management had the greatest impact on corporate healthcare costs
